An electric iron rated 750 W is operated for 2 hours/day. How much energy is consumed by the electric iron for 30 days?

उत्तर

Data Given: Power = 750 W,
Time = 2 hours per day,
No. of days = 30 days.

Energy consumed = Power Rating x time of operation.
 
Therefore, Energy consumed = 750 W x 2 hrs x 30 days = 45000 W hour
 
Therefore, Energy consumed = (45000 / 1000 ) kWh.
 
Therefore, Energy consumed = 45 kWh.
 
Therefore, Energy consumed by the electric iron is 45 kWh.
